Die Zahlungsdaten von Shopify Payments werden über eine API-Schnittstelle zu PayJoe übertragen. Dafür müssen Sie einmalig in der Oberfläche von PayJoe einen Shopify Payments-Zugang anlegen und diesen laut unserer Anleitung konfigurieren.
Sie sind gerade dabei einen Zugang zum Anbinden von Shopify Payments in PayJoe anzulegen (siehe Zugänge ) oder haben diesen Vorgang bereits abgeschlossen.
Damit PayJoe die Zahlungsdaten von Shopify Payments abrufen kann, müssen Sie den lesenden Zugriff auf Ihr Zahlungsdaten aus dem Shopify-Shop genehmigen.
1. Tragen Sie Ihre Shop-URL in das dafür vorgesehene Feld ein.
Die eingetragene URL muss folgender Struktur entsprechen: meinshop.myshopify.com. Wenn diese Struktur nicht eingehalten wird, kann der Zugriff auf Ihre Shopify Payments-Zahlungen nicht erfolgen.
a. Melden Sie sich in Ihrem Shopify-Account an.
b. Klicken Sie im Shopify-Adminbereich auf .
c. Auf Apps erstellen klicken.
d. Auf Benutzerdefinierte App-Entwicklung erlauben klicken.
e. Lesen Sie die bereitgestellte Warnung und die Informationen und klicken Sie dann auf Benutzerdefinierte App-Entwicklung erlauben.
a. Klicken Sie im Shopify-Adminbereich auf .
b. Auf Apps entwickeln klicken.
c. Auf Apps im Dev Dashboard erstellen klicken.
d. Klicken Sie auf Create app.
e. Geben Sie im neu geöffneten Fenster den App-Namen PayJoe ein und klicken anschließend auf Create.
f. Klicken Sie unter "Access" auf die Verlinkung Request Access
g. Klicken Sie unter "Anforderung zusätzlicher Bereiche und APIs" auf Distribution auswählen
h. Klicken Sie auf Benutzerdefinierte Verteilung und anschließend auf Auswählen
i. Klicken Sie auf Benutzerdefinierte Verteilung auswählen (der nun geöffnete Tab kann geschlossen werden)
j. Klicken Sie unter "Access" auf die Verlinkung Request Access
k. Klicken Sie unter "Alle im Bereich vorhandene Bestellungen lesen" auf Zugriff anfordern
l. Geben Sie folgenden Text ein: "Der Zugriff wird aufgrund der ordnungsgemäßen Buchführung benötigt." und klicken anschließend auf Zugriff anfordern. Die Seite kann nun geschlossen werden.
m. Gehen Sie zurück auf dev.shopify.com und aktualisieren Sie die Seite, damit die Änderungen in der angelegten App aktiv werden.
n. Geben Sie unter "URLs" die folgende URL ein: https://shopify.dev/apps/default-app-home und entfernen die Haken bei "Embed app in Shopify admin"
o. Geben Sie unter "Scopes" folgende Berechtigungen ein:
read_all_orders,read_customers,read_orders,read_shopify_payments_accounts,read_shopify_payments_payouts
Der Text kann einfach in das Eingabefeld kopiert werden.
p. Klicken Sie auf Release und anschließend nochmals auf Release
q. Klicken Sie auf "Settings" und Tragen Sie die "Client ID" und "Secret" Ihrer benutzerdefinierten App aus Shopify in die dafür vorgesehenen Felder in PayJoe ein.
r. Klicken Sie auf "Home" und anschließend auf Install app
s. Wählen Sie Ihren Shop aus und klicken im nächsten Fenster auf Install
t. Gehen Sie zurück in PayJoe. Tragen Sie das Startdatum ein, ab dem die Zahlungsdaten von Shopify Payments abgeholt werden sollen.
u. Klicken Sie auf Weiter.
Legen Sie für diese Transaktionen Buchungsvorlagen in Ihrem Buchhaltungssystem an. Dann werden diese Daten automatisch auf das gewünschte Konto gebucht.
Folgende Tabelle gibt Ihnen einen Überblick über die von PayJoe fest vorgegebenen Transaktionen und ihren Verwendungszweck für Shopify Payments.
| Art der Transaktion | Ausgabe |
|---|---|
| Servicegebühr | SHFY‑SG‑[Waehrung] |
| Bestellgebühr | SHFY-BG‑[Waehrung]‑[ShopifyPaymentsTransaktionsID] |
| Auszahlungsbetrag | SHFY-AUSZ-[Währung]-[Datum] |
In der folgenden Tabelle sehen Sie die einzelnen Gebühren, die Shopify Payments zur Verfügung stellt. Da die Originalbezeichnungen der Gebühren zu viele Zeichen enthalten, gibt PayJoe immer die Abkürzungen im Verwendungszweck mit aus.
| Gebühr | Abkürzung |
|---|---|
| application_fee_refund | PPLCTNFR |
| debit | debit |
| dispute-reversal | DSPTRVRS |
| dispute-withdrawal | DSPTWTHD |
| payout | payout |
| reserved_funds_reversal | RSRVDFN1 |
| reserved_funds_withdrawal | RSRVDFND |
| transfer | transfer |